The Founders’ Gala | April 5th – 6pm at The Gaelic American Club
Ireland’s Great Hunger Museum of Fairfield will unveil the latest additions to the collection and host an informative evening of Fine Art, Live & Silent Auctions, Open Bar with Food provided by The Castle Blackrock. $150 Per Person. This event will not only mark the official debut of two remarkable pieces being added to the museum’s collection but also celebrate the unwavering support and dedication of the local Irish-American community to the mission of the IGHMF.
Donated for this special event, the emotive bronze piece symbolizes enduring love and resilience, themes that resonate deeply with the museum’s mission. Notably, the most recent edition of Later Love was auctioned at Ireland’s Solomon’s Galleries, where it fetched an impressive €11,000, underscoring the significant value and admiration Gillespie’s work commands. This donation promises to add both artistic and historical richness to the gala festivities.
